Last year during muzzleloader season I saw a white yearling. I say "white" because I didn't see any brown spots at all, but I was too far to tell if it was a true albino. It had a full grown brown doe with it. I watched it for about 15 minutes as it fed off. Never offered me a shot, but I wouldn't shoot a yearling albino deer anyway. A mature doe or buck would have been shot by me though. Definately a trophy to me.
I never saw it again last year, and I figured it didn't survive because if it color.
This past weekend I let my brother in law sit in a stand about 150 yards from where I was last year and he seen a white doe (I think it was the same one.) This one had a brown patch on its right rear ham. I think it was the same one.
I was glad to hear that it made it through last season.
